Karl Foerster grass is extremely tall and narrow with feathery stalks that rise above the green foliage in mid-Summer and persist into winter. The blooms emerge reddish, then fade to a golden tan for the rest of the season. It forms a neat clump and works well in foundation plantings, mass plantings, and as an upright accent plant. This grass is low maintenance but needs to be cut back when it is dormant.
This grass performs best in full sun and tends to flop out in more shade. It will tolerate a wide variety of soils, including wet soils. It doesn’t have any serious pest or disease issues.
